      Madrid Athletic boasts a formidable home record in La Liga. This season, they've played 19 home games, securing 15 wins, 1 draw, and 3 losses, with an impressive win - rate of 78.9%. They've scored 39 goals and conceded 17, resulting in a +22 goal difference and 46 points, placing them 4th in the league. The team's recent form has been stable. In the last 6 matches, they've won 4 and lost 2. On average, they score 1.5 goals per game on the offensive end and concede 0.9 goals per game on the defensive end. Their home offensive and defensive efficiency ranks among the top in the league. Overall, Madrid Athletic has 21 wins, 6 draws, and 11 losses, accumulating 69 points and sitting 4th in La Liga. Their home win - rate far exceeds their away win - rate of 31.6%, clearly showing their home - field advantage. On the other hand, Malaga, a team from the Segunda División, has a relatively mediocre away record. In 21 away games, they've won 9, drawn 3, and lost 9, with a win - rate of 42.9%.

      Madrid Athletic's core attacking line is fully staffed, though there are concerns about the fitness of some rotational defenders during the pre - season preparation. In the first round of the new season, the scorching 33 - degree weather took a toll on the players' physical strength. However, the team boasts a well - established defensive system and a deep bench, allowing for flexible rotation and adjustment. As a newly - promoted team, Malaga has some rotational players in the backline out due to injury, but the main squad is mostly intact. After being away from La Liga for many years, the overall depth of their roster is limited. Playing away against a strong opponent, their defense will face significant pressure, and their ability to strengthen the squad with substitutes in the second half is relatively weak.       Madrid's Athletic Club is well - known for its solid defense. However, during the preseason preparation, their form has been quite inconsistent. In four friendly matches, they conceded a total of seven goals, losing to Manchester United and Manchester City successively, with an average of more than one goal conceded per game. What's more critical is that the team's main center - forward, Saul Ñíguez, is in doubt for the game due to a muscle injury. This directly weakens Atlético Madrid's aerial dominance and the pivotal role in the penalty area. To make up for this gap, Atlético Madrid is bound to increase flanking attacks, through - balls into the channels, and long - range shots from the edge of the box. While this tactical adjustment can diversify their offensive methods, it also makes the defense more vulnerable when the players push forward, leaving more gaps in the backline.
